Finally, we come down to the most productive HDRip scene group today, which is SiNNERS. We first cover a 1991 movie from them. “JFK” is an American film directed by Oliver Stone. The film examines the events leading to the assassination of President John F. Kennedy, and alleged subsequent cover-up, through the eyes of former New Orleans district attorney Jim Garrison.

PLOT: A mixture of fact and speculation surrounding the death of U.S. President John F. Kennedy on 22nd November, 1963. New Orleans District Attorney, Jim Garrison, re-opens the files on the investigation and takes a critical look at the facts given by the F.B.I. His persistent questioning and poking his nose where it shouldn’t be causes his and his family’s lives to be at risk. But he keeps on the trail and soon uncovers a lead which points to the war in Vietnam.
